Abstract
We introduce a scale dependent stability number which describes the respons e of a dynamical system to finite size perturbations. By construction, it c onverges to the maximal Lyapunov exponent in the limit of infinitesimal per turbations. We discuss different dynamical systems which are linearly stabl e but unstable in terms of the finite size analysis. In such a situation ty pical trajectories can show temporal disorder, which has its origin in a ki nd of mixing on the mesoscopic scales.
